CH177240 - Sanctionable conduct by tax advisers: file access notice: appeal against a file access notice: document holder is a tax adviser

A file access notice issued to a tax adviser that has been pre-approved by the Tribunal may not be appealed.

If we issue a file access notice without Tribunal approval, the tax adviser may appeal the file access notice or any requirement within it.

The notice of appeal must be given

  • in writing to the officer who issued the file access notice, and
  • within 30 days of the file access notice being issued.

The notice of appeal must state the grounds of appeal.

The tribunal may confirm, vary or set aside the notice or a requirement in it following an appeal. The tribunal’s decision is final.

FA12/SCH38/PARA20
